2015 Chevy Cruze - A/C Off Due to High Engine Temp and Loud Fan
I've been dealing with my car making obnoxious fan noises for a few months, at first it would only do it while the A/C was running but now it does it a few moments after the car starts and won't turn off.
Back in July the engine overheated to the point I had to pull over and eventually took it to get serviced. They fixed leaking Coolant, replaced the valve cover gasket and the engine valve cover.
But a month later it is still making loud fan noises and I can't have my A/C running when I drive or Mt engine will overheat. I have an appointment to see the dealership in a week but as of now I have absolutely no idea what's wrong, considering many people have this issue but never actually say what they did to resolve the issue.
